  1. Cook County, 13 miles west of the Chicago Loop. Except for a handful of old farmhouses scattered throughout the village and a few streets named after German farmers who once owned the land, little remains of the nearly 150-year history of farming in the area that became Westchester.

  6. Westchester is a village in Cook County, Illinois, United States. It is a western suburb of Chicago. The population was 16,892 at the 2020 census.

  7. About. In 2021, Westchester, IL had a population of 16.8k people with a median age of 49.3 and a median household income of $94,151. Between 2020 and 2021 the population of Westchester, IL grew from 16,255 to 16,837, a 3.58% increase and its median household income grew from $88,861 to $94,151, a 5.95% increase.
